http://www.selotips.com/cara-overclock-motherboard-gigabyte/ WebCRT Monitors, for example, consume more power when the screen is white. As opposed to LCD, where black uses slightly more energy to display a black screen as the display relies on an array of thin-tube fluorescent bulbs that provide a constant source of light to create a white screen. To make it black, LCDs rely on a diffuser to block this light.

Learn to overclock, ask experienced users your questions, boast your rock-stable, … blue diamond cooking utensilsWebNov 29, 2024 · To set an automatic overclock, click on Profile 1 or Profile 2 and set ”Control Mode” to ”Auto Overclocking” on the right pane. Just below that, you’ll find the ”Boost Override CPU” setting. Use this to increase the clock speed and let Ryzen Master manage the voltage accordingly.
